Subject: LiftSim cut-over — short version for the sync

Hi all,

The LiftSim elevator-dispatch simulator is now fully on the new Marrowgate cluster. Cut-over took about 40 minutes, mostly waiting on the scenario cache to warm. Dispatch latency in sims is down noticeably, and the old instance is frozen for two weeks in case we need to roll back. For anyone poking at it this week, here's the running config:

deployment values, kajep-kageg:
[praix]
host = praix.paliqcorp.corp
user = praix_svc
database = praix_prod

Management Meeting Minutes — Reseller Programme

Present: Dena Forsgate, Ollie Rennick, Priya Calloway.

Quick recap: the Fernlight reseller programme is tracking ahead of plan — 14 partners signed versus the 10 we'd hoped for. Margins are a bit thinner than modelled, mostly down to the tiered discount we offered early joiners. Ollie will tighten the discount bands before the next intake. Where we want to take the programme next is covered in the note below.

board note of yahip-tadug: Headcount on the Zorath team goes from 9 to 100 by the end of April. Gross margin on Zorath came in at 10 percent against a plan of 20 percent.

/*
 * Client setup for Hollowgate, the audio-guide backend used by the
 * Marrowick Museum app. This client streams narration manifests and
 * exhibit metadata. Timeouts are set to 4s because gallery Wi-Fi is
 * unreliable; retries are capped at two. Discussed at the eng sync:
 * the staging client authenticates against the internal manifest
 * service with the key on the next line.
 */

service key, bajog-yahop: kto7_mMHVCpJ

## Runbook: Flagstone rollout framework — promotion step

Promotion moves a flag config from staging to the production Flagstone registry. The release manager runs the promote script, which diffs the config, records the approval, and publishes. Canary at 5% for 30 minutes; watch the Flagstone error dashboard before raising to 50%. Published configs are rejected by edge nodes unless signed. Before running promote, export the registry signing key shown below.

rollout seal: bky4_sSmA